Rachel came to Victory Church in 2011 through Mary’s Song our women’s restoration center. Being a product of a broken home laden with drug addiction and mental illness, she followed in the footsteps of her parents and endured a twenty-five-year battle with mental illness and addiction that led to a suicide attempt that nearly took her life. In December 2011, she was arrested and led to Mary’s Song through prison ministry. There she encountered the love of Christ; the chains of mental illness and addiction were broken off of her life and she was filled with the joy of the Lord. She later completed the program, was asked to join the staff and now she is the director. In 2018, she received her Associates Degree in Biblical Studies and became a licensed minister. She has also had the pleasure of becoming a chaplain at Jefferson Parish Correctional Center, a certified belief therapist through Therapon, and she is currently enrolled at Oral Roberts University pursuing a degree in psychology. On the eight-year anniversary of her life-transforming encounter with the love of Jesus, she was married to a long-time deacon of the church. In Christ, Rachel has been healed, restored and given a brand-new life! Today it is her great joy to be able to share the love of Jesus with other women just like herself and encourage them to partake of the newness of life offered to them in Christ.
